Hollywood star Robert Pattinson recently admitted that he still gets trolled for playing vampire Edward Cullen in Twilight.

Hollywood star Robert Pattinson is still being scouted to play Edward Cullen in Twilight. The actor said that people still never miss a chance to tell him how his portrayal in the film ruined the vampire genre.
Speaking to GQ Spain, Pattinson shared, “I love that people keep saying to me, ‘Man, ‘Twilight’ ruined the vampire genre. Are you still stuck on that thing? You How can one be sad about something that happened almost 20 years ago? This is crazy.”
Twilight was released in 2008, and turned Pattinson and co-star Kristen Stewart into household names overnight. Pattinson played the blood-sucking lead in five films of the franchise.
Director and producer Catherine Hardwicke had previously revealed in an interview that the studio did not want Pattinson in the lead role. At the time, fans wanted Superman star Henry Cavill to play the vampire.
